Objectives

Narrative objectives1

The purpose of this study is to evaluate levels of different tau proteins using [18F]PM-PBB3 and [11C]PBB3 along with changes in synaptic density in patients with dementia and healthy subjects.

Assessment

Primary outcomes

Difference in [18F]PM-PBB3 binding, and [11C]PBB3 binding. Changes in [11C]UCB-J

Key secondary outcomes

Correlations between [11C]UCB-J and tau deposition
